FanDuel NBA Lineup Advice: Wednesday (2/28)

There are nine games on deck for Wednesday and we have a strong fantasy slate to close out the month of February. The Clippers, Wizards, Bucks, and Hornets all played last night, with the final three in that list also playing their third game in four nights. Tonight marks the fourth game in six days for the Bucks, who are also traveling across a time zone after hosting a nationally televised game last night, so be cognizant of that tidbit when creating lineups. The Pelicans, Rockets, and Pistons are also playing their third game in four nights, but they did have yesterday off. Everyone else is coming off of at least one day of rest, with the Spurs having a couple to recoup. There are some bloated totals on the board tonight, with five contests sporting projected totals over 215 points, so this should be a good night for fantasy scoring.
